A Competition Built Around the World's Three Greatest Strength Movements

Every serious lifter understands that true strength is measured through compound movements that recruit nearly every major muscle group. That is why the Squat Bench Deadlift competition format has become the gold standard for testing overall strength worldwide.

Squat

The squat is often called the king of all exercises. Athletes perform a back squat with a loaded barbell while maintaining proper technique and depth. The squat evaluates lower body power, core stability, balance, mobility, and technical precision — success requires months or years of disciplined training rather than brute force alone.

Bench Press

The bench press measures upper-body pressing strength while demanding strict control throughout the movement. Competitors lower the barbell to the chest before pressing it back to lockout according to competition standards — challenging chest strength, shoulder stability, triceps power, bar control, and technical execution. Even experienced gym-goers quickly realize that competition bench pressing requires significantly more precision than ordinary training sessions.

Deadlift

Few lifts symbolize pure strength like the deadlift. Starting from the floor, athletes lift the loaded barbell until standing fully upright. It develops posterior chain strength, grip strength, core stability, mental toughness, and explosive power — and many spectators consider it the highlight of every Powerlifting event Chandigarh because of its dramatic finishes and incredible displays of determination.

Preparing for Bar Wars 2026

Focus on Technique

Perfecting movement mechanics in the squat, bench press, and deadlift improves efficiency while reducing the risk of injury. Consistent technical practice often leads to greater improvements than simply increasing training volume.

Train Progressively

Gradually increasing weights over time allows the body to adapt safely while building maximum strength for competition day — the same progressive overload principle that drives results at Box to Fit.

Prioritize Recovery

Quality sleep, mobility work, hydration, and balanced nutrition are essential for maintaining performance throughout a demanding training cycle.

Practice Competition Standards

Training under competition-like conditions helps athletes build confidence and prepares them for lifting under pressure when it matters most.

Build Mental Strength

Competitive lifting requires focus and resilience. Visualizing successful lifts and maintaining a disciplined mindset can make a significant difference on event day — a quality Box to Fit actively develops through its boxing-inspired training approach.
